SC issues interim order not to implement appointing expert member of NOC



KATHMANDU: The Supreme Court has issued an interim order to immediately hold the implementation of government decision to appoint Sahadev Bogati as an ‘expert member’ of Nepal Oil Corporation Board of Directors.

A division bench of Justice Iswori Prasad Khatiwada and Nahakul Subedi on Friday ordered the government not to bring the decision into effect reasoning that Bogati did not have the knowledge and experience required to work as an expert member.

“The expert appointed should apparently have necessary ‘knowledge and experience’ on the concerned subject to be chosen as an expert of the board of directors while seeing the working nature of the NOC,” read the directive order.

Bogati’s educational qualification is only School Leaving Certificate and is found to be involved in Rural Water Supply and Sanitation and Development Board and Chairperson of Khaptad Area Tourism Development Committee. These credentials are not enough to appoint him as expert member at NOC, reiterated the order.
